莠去津吸附的土壤淋溶柱色谱法研究

摘    要:采用新发展的土壤淋溶柱色谱法,研究农药在水-土壤体系中的吸附。用土壤装填成液相色谱柱,以农药水溶液为流动相,以除草剂莠去津(2-氯-4-乙胺基-6-异丙胺基-s-三嗪)为例,质量浓度从19.73μg/L至29.60mg/L,紫外检测器监测吸附平衡。吸附相中莠去津的质量浓度经甲醇淋洗液的测定值扣除柱内液相中的质量浓度后得到。对于极稀溶液,可采用在ODS柱上富集-液相色谱台阶梯度法测定。莠去津在沙壤土上的吸附行为符合Freundlich方程式,其吸附常数Kf=842.6mL/kg。

Study on Adsorption of Atrazine by Soil Leaching Column Chromatography

Abstract:A recently developed soil leaching column chromatography was applied to study the adsorption of pesticide in water\|soil system. Soil was filled directly into a liquid chromatographic column and pesticide solution was applied as an eluant, and the adsorption equilibrium was monitored by a UV detector. The herbicide atrazine, i. e. 2\|chloro\|4\|ethylamino\|6\|isopropylamino\|s\|triazine, was chosen as an example. Its mass concentration ranged from 19.73 mg/L to 29.60 g/L. After the soil phase was rinsed with methanol, the amount of atrazine adsorbed was calculated from the difference between the atrazine totally rinsed and that in solution in the column. The low content atrazine sample was determined by enrichment on an ODS column and step\|gradient method. It shows that the adsorption of atrazine on a sandy loam soil is in accordance with Freundlich isotherm. The adsorption coefficient K f is 842.6 mL/kg and the normalized organic carbon adsorption coefficient log K oc is 1.832.
